Πούντα Πλακών
Πούντα Πλακών is a peak in South Aegean Islands, Greek Islands and has an elevation of 165 metres. Πούντα Πλακών is situated nearby to the locality Μπετόνη, as well as near Κάλαμος.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Psathi is a small settlement in Ios, Greece. It is located 8 km from Chora, the capital of Ios and 200 km from Athens.
